An electromagnetic analogue of gravitational wave memory

We present an electromagnetic analog of gravitational wave memory. That is,\nwe consider what change has occurred to a detector of electromagnetic radiation\nafter the wave has passed. Rather than a distortion in the detector, as occurs\nin the gravitational wave case, we find a residual velocity (a "kick") to the\ncharges in the detector. In analogy with the two types of gravitational wave\nmemory ("ordinary" and "nonlinear") we find two types of electromagnetic kick.\n
